CHATEAU SANSONNET 2005 Saint Emilion Grand Cru, 12 bottles (cased) Situated on the highest level in the region and famous for its seductive rounded and perfectly made wines. Some consider this to be the best ever Sansonnet in recent decades. The wine will keep but as with most right bank wines the preponderance of Merlot in the blend means less long ageing tannins. It will keep for another couple of years but it is perfect to enjoy now. It has a beautiful nose a deep colour and has spicy notes, hints of coffee, supported by dark fruit. Wine Spectator 93/100

CHATEAU DE LA COUR 2005 Saint Emilion Grand Cru, 12 bottles (cased) A very small and relatively new Chateau (30 years) owned by the Delacour family. This wine is certainly at its peak and should be drunk within the year. Slightly austere but deep in colour, a nice aged claret nose and good finish.

A FRENCH SILVER TASTEVIN, WORKMASTER MARTIAL GAUTHIER, PARIS, 1888-1902 the bowl of the tastevin finished with a typical arrangement of pearls and an elongated gadroon, designed to create reflections in the wine to better judge its clarity and color, inset at the base with a 1774 coin bearing the likeness on King Louis XV, Minerva head, master's mark, diameter: 7.5 cm (3 in.), weight: 85.9 g (2.76 ozt)This lot is being sold without reserve. PROVENANCEAcquired through inheritance by the descendants of Alexander Ivanovich Nelidov (1835-1910), Russian Ambassador to Turkey, Italy and FranceCollection of the Nelidov family to the present day

A group of late 19th Century to early 20th Century James Powell & Sons (Whitefriars) wine glasses, comprising an example designed by Philip Webb with an ogee bowl above a wrythen stem and plain circular foot, all in a pale green tint, height 13cm, a pair of sea green glasses with ogee bowls, plain stems and feet, two glasses designed by T.G. Jackson with ogee bowls, inverted baluster stems and plain feet, and two in dark green designed by Harry Powell, one with slight ribbing. (7)
An early 20th Century Stevens & Williams double colour cased wine glass having a slender ogee form bowl with everted rim cased in blue over citron over clear and flash cut with a triple S form scroll with palmette motifs and foliate scrolls all above a clear crystal baluster form stem and circular spread foot with matched decoration, pattern number 38844, circa 1908, height 21cm.
